Marilyn Jean (Rosener) Cash, 89, Festus
Marilyn Jean (Rosener) Cash, 89, of Festus died Oct. 11, 2023, in Festus. Mrs. Cash worked as a riverboat cook for many years. She was a member of Sacred Heart Catholic Church in Crystal City. She enjoyed flowers, shopping, dancing, and spending time with family. Born Aug. 24, 1934, in Bonne Terre, she was the daughter of the late Wallace E. and Pearl L. (Daugherty) Rosener.
